gammy adjective [ ˈɡami ]

• (of part of a person's body, especially the leg) unable to function normally because of injury or chronic pain.
• "he had a gammy leg, it had steel in it or something"
Origin: mid 19th century (in the sense ‘bad, false’): dialect form of game2.
